Prince Harry’s Surprise FaceTime on *MasterChef Australia*: A Wholesome Glimpse into the Sussexes’ World
On Sunday evening, Australian viewers tuning into *MasterChef Australia* were treated to more than just high-stakes cooking. During Meghan, Duchess of Sussex’s guest-judging appearance, Prince Harry dialled in via FaceTime in a moment that felt both spontaneous and carefully staged for maximum charm. The episode, filmed in April 2026 at the Melbourne Showgrounds during the couple’s four-day private visit to Australia, saw Meghan mentoring contestants alongside regular judges Poh Ling Yeow, Sofia Levin and Jean-Christophe Novelli. Contestants faced the challenge of creating a “dish fit for a Duchess” using seasonal ingredients Meghan helped select — including honey, macadamia nuts, citrus, edible flowers and celeriac. The brief emphasised personal storytelling and nostalgia in the food.
